I'm trying to install Mac Os Mojave 10.14.5 in my NUC7i7BNH ( 8gb Ram + 500Gb Sata SSD ) following RehabMan guide, and for some steps I used a vmware version of Mojave in other PC, but once I reach the installer, there is not internet even using IntelMausiEthernet.
The Details...
I'm using the latest config.plist, and kext version from the guide, also during the first attempt I got a curious: "This copy of the Install macOS Mojave application is damaged, and can't be used to install macOS." and the solution for it was delete the InstallInfo.plist from <app>/Contents/SharedSupport/InstallInfo.plist, that allowed me to reach the installed but once there I found there was not internet so after checking using the console I only found gif0, stf0 and XHC20 interfaces but not en0 therefore I assume clover is not loading or something similar the proper kext.
